L-Shaped Sectionals
When you think of sectionals, your thoughts might immediately turn to large l shaped sectional leather-shaped sofas which can comfortably accommodate many people. There are a variety of styles to choose from.
For instance, you may come across a modular sectional which includes individual pieces that can be placed and rearranged to meet your needs. This type of sectional is perfect for living rooms where layouts or seating requirements change regularly.
Versatility
If you're planning to design an area for your living room or home theater An L-shaped sofa is an option that can complement your design aesthetic and fit into your space. The ideal seating arrangement can improve the look of any space and create it a cozy space for entertaining or relaxing. These designs are adaptable and come in a variety of sizes that will fit most spaces. The right sectional size will impact the aesthetics and comfort. Accurate measurements and consideration of the layout of your room will assist you in choosing a sectional that fits perfectly to the space.
L-shaped sectionals are available in a variety of styles, ranging from classic corner shapes to chaise sofas as well as modern modular designs. They also provide a range of upholstery options, ranging from pet-friendly and stain-resistant fabrics to tough leather. These materials are durable and can withstand wear and tear. They also provide an inviting, luxurious feel to your Wisconsin home. Certain manufacturers also offer customization options which allow you to pick the upholstery and fabric that best suits your lifestyle preferences.

Space-saving
One of the most important features that separate sectionals from regular sofas is their ability to fit into a space more easily, especially in smaller spaces. The L-shaped sectionals are ideal for corner spaces and are able to accommodate a large number of people during family movie nights as well as casual gatherings. They can also serve to create a subtle room divide without obscuring the view in open-plan homes.
It is essential to select the correct sectional for your home in order to have an enjoyable seating arrangement. Take into consideration the size of your room as well as the furniture in the room, as well as the traffic flow. You'll want to ensure that the sofa is large enough to allow for movement and is in harmony with the decor of the room.
Some sectionals are pre-determined, while others are modular. This lets you change the seating arrangement however you'd prefer. They can also be fitted with extras like recliners or storage built-in. Some models are adjusted to height to accommodate users of different age groups.
Based on your particular needs, it may be beneficial to invest in an L-shaped sectional which includes both a right and left arm sofa that has an attached chaise lounge in the back. This type of sectional can be a good option for families with larger families who frequently organize parties or events. This type of configuration is also a great option for those who have a pet and wish to keep them away from the seating area, as they won't be able catch the cushion covers or pillows.

Comfort
A sectional is a great option if you're searching for the ideal seating solution for your living space. It is a great seating option while taking up less space than a traditional sofa or loveseat, and it is available in a wide variety of sizes and styles. It can also be fitted with a chaise, or ottoman to increase comfort and versatility.
Take into consideration the overall aesthetics and comfort of the sectional as well as the lifestyle you live. Numerous manufacturers offer a wide variety of upholstery options, from plush leather to slick linen. The fabric you choose will influence the look and feel of your sofa but it can also affect its durability and maintenance requirements. If you have pets or children A stain-resistant fabric may be better for your requirements. A light color or delicate fabric can be easily damaged by pet hair or spills from food.
In addition to the ease of the design, it is important to take a look at the strength of the sectional. To ensure durability and stability A reputable brand will employ the kiln-dried wood frames. This will help the sofa endure years of use and constant entertaining. Certain brands employ sinuous springs to provide support and comfort.
You should also consider the budget when you are shopping for a sectional. The price of a sofa sectional is determined by its size, materials, and features. A larger sectional is likely to be more expensive than one that is smaller. A sectional with reclined seats will also cost more than a non-reclining model. To estimate the cost of a sectional, visit a store and look at prices. This will allow you to decide which option is the most affordable.
Style
Sectionals with L-shapes can be customized to suit your space and style preferences. For instance, certain configurations let you include a chaise lounge to provide extra seating or a built-in storage compartment to further organize. Some sofas have cushions that can be removed to simplify cleaning and maintenance. These features make these sofas a fantastic option for families with children or pets. To extend the durability and life of your sofa, opt for high-performance fabrics that are resistant to spills, stains and wear. Regular fluffing can also prevent the upholstery from flattening or sliding.
When you are looking for a new small l shaped sofa-shaped sectional it is important to think about the overall value and quality of the furniture. In addition to the initial price you should consider other factors like upholstery as well as construction materials and size. In general, a bigger sectional will carry an increased price tag than smaller ones due to the more expensive materials and production costs. Also, be sure to take into account the ongoing repairs and maintenance costs.
The design of an l segmental can help you make the most of corner spaces and create cozy seating areas to relax or entertain. They are also ideal for smaller apartments and living rooms where saving space is an important factor. They can also be used as room dividers to define seating areas in larger houses without obstructing views or causing disruption to traffic.
The most appropriate fabric for your sectional is vital for maintaining its comfort and style. Fabrics come in a variety of shades, patterns and textures. This makes it easy to match your decor. You should also choose an item that's durable and easy to clean. If you have pets or children select fabrics that are stain-resistant or pet-friendly to avoid permanent stains.
After you've selected the best fabric for your sectional, it's time to think about the sizes and layout options. Measure the area where you plan to put the couch and also consider any furniture or architectural features. You'll also want to consider the amount of clearance required to move around the couch l shaped.
